The poems and prose of Perfectly Still were destined for the trashcan. But author Lezlie Laws says, “a slim folder of poems just kept hovering like a shy kitten on the periphery of the stacks of paper headed for the trash.” Out went class materials, student papers, course curricula, but this folder lingered, and thank God it did. Law says, “I found a version of myself I had rarely shared, and I realized I wasn’t quite ready to part with it. I found a tenderness and a vulnerability that I hoped might serve as guides to my next decade. I discovered notions soft and quiet, feelings of ease and acceptance.” May you feel the same in reading Laws’ amazing words.
